As a Liverpool fan I hope the Gilette/Hicks takeover is good news and not 'asset stripping'. To be fair something like this was inevitable for LFC as there was no way the Moores family were going to raise the multi-millions needed to build the new stadium and more specifically create the regeneration of Anfield the area needs. More importantly it enables LFC to compete with Man Utd and Chelsea in the transfer market - although spending money doesn't always guarantee success, and will hopefully give the reds a firm financial footing rather than the current debt ridden situation that it and most of the rest of the Premiership are in at the moment.
